The 15-minute, noninvasive ultrasound is similar to the one a pregnant person would have: gel is applied to the abdomen and a probe is rolled over the area. The latest in inflammatory bowel disease treatment UChicago Medicine is the second hospital in the country to routinely offer IUS, prompting patients from across the U.S. Now she has something far better – the University of Chicago Medicine’s new, state-of-the-art intestinal ultrasound (IUS) program. And with intestinal ultrasound, instead of having to do stool tests and colonoscopies, we could use this and do it as frequently as we want because it doesn't hurt and it doesn't involve radiation or prep. So Crohn's disease can recur or come back after surgery, especially at that connection site. So in Sharon's case, a case where a patient had Crohn's in a small intestine and had a resection or removal of that bowel that is involved- and what's beautiful about intestine ultrasound, we could assess for recurrence. Again, we can see a very thin wall right here. And you can make decisions based on that during the clinic visits. So you can do this scan in clinic and give patients real-time results. Intestinal ultrasound is a noninvasive tool to assess disease activity in patients with inflammatory bowel disease, such as Crohn's and ulcerative colitis. Since your baby’s eyes are still developing, earthy shades give them a break from the overstimulating world of bright colors and contrasts. Natural earth shades have a grounding effect and can create a homey atmosphere. Adding wooden furniture or traditional-style decor will help round out the vibe. Avoid blue whites and stick to creamier shades like off-whites to avoid a cold and institutional feel. Whites go exceptionally well with cozy bedding and fluffy rugs, all of which create a cuddly environment for babies. White shades are good for nurseries since they are airy and soothing and evoke feelings of innocence and purity. Neutral colors also provide a canvas for photos, wall art, and bedspreads that won’t conflict with the display. Also, neutral colors work well with both traditional and modern furniture, so you won’t be stuck with one decor style if you change your mind. Neutral colors come in handy if you’re waiting until birth to find out your baby’s gender - you can add colors as your child gets older. Image used with permission by copyright holder Neutral colors for a nursery Remember, you’re going for calm and soothing, not loud or old-fashioned. Purples tend to appear darker than expected once applied to walls, so if you find a color you like in the bright lights of the hardware store, go at least one shade lighter, and you won’t regret it. ![]() Soft purples like lilac create a peaceful environment, but choosing a light shade is super important. Purple is often associated with royalty and spirituality and combines the soothing feelings of light blues with the nurturing feelings of pale pinks. Shades of powder blue, light turquoise, and aqua are your best bet when it comes to blues. Be sure to avoid dark blues if you want to create a sleepy space since darker blues can have an energizing effect and can prevent sleep. Blues have been proven to decrease feelings of anxiety and aggression, making them perfect for newborns and babies. ![]() Check out our gallery to get inspired by the latest nursery color trends.The colors of the sea or sky tend to relax the body and mind and provide an overall sense of comfort. Traditional nursery colors like blues, purples and grays are also still popular, but designers are finding ways to break convention with even the most traditional or muted color palettes. Many designers are also using color to infuse life and personality into the nursery, whether this means pops of happy colors or delightfully unconventional color choices. ![]() “Creating a cozy, calming space for those endless diaper changes and night feeding sessions is so essential, and I’ve found that comfort in a nursery is key,” says Julia Miller of Yond Interiors. Saturated hues like marigold, burgundy and mauve are especially big, like in this nursery from Yond Interiors, where the rich burgundies and caramels are a nice contrast to the neutral grays. We scouted around for popular nursery color palettes and noticed a trend toward warm colors that favor serenity and sophistication over cuteness or glamour. When deciding on a palette for your baby’s first bedroom, you’ll want colors that are playful but also pleasant for grownups, since you’ll probably be spending many hours in the nursery. Colors play a big role in determining the mood of your nursery.
